Furthermore, the industry is experiencing a notable expansion in the application of AI for medical imaging, which is leading the market growth as AI technologies are increasingly integrated into radiology and pathology services. AI-powered tools can detect subtle anomalies in X-rays, MRIs, and CT scans that may be missed by the human eye, improving detection rates and reducing diagnostic errors. Market solutions are evolving to offer AI-assisted triage and prioritization of critical findings. This ability to enhance the speed and accuracy of image interpretation is a powerful driver, helping to alleviate radiologist workloads and improve patient care.
